Blue Monday, often regarded as the "most depressing day of the year," falls on the third Monday of January. On this day, the combination of post-holiday blues, winter weather, and other factors can increase feelings of loneliness and sadness, particularly among seniors. However, there is hope ..read more

Angie Harvey and her partner John moved into Origin at Longwood in 2021. A former school teacher she has always had a passion for learning – and when she combine this with her love of bringing cheer to her friends and neighbors, Smile Pages was born. Since her move into Origin at Longwood she has been gracing our shelfs and displays with these learned-funnies and even recently catching the eye of CTV’s Adam Sawatski who did a little exposé on her – taking the story provincial across British Columbia.  ..read more
